草庐IT

express-router

全部标签

VS2022 IIS Express运行报错:Could not load file or assembly ‘xxxx‘ or one of its dependencies.

问题描述:VS2017,VS2019默认使用32位的IISExpress运行应用程序。但VS2022默认启用64位的IISExpress。如果项目中有dll必须运行在32位下,就会造成标题所示的错误。解决办法:VS2022中工具=》选项=》项目与方案=》Web项目下将“使用64位的IISExpress”选项勾掉就可以了。 

html - 使用 router.navigate 时更改导航栏中的事件选项卡

我将Angular2与Bootstrap4结合使用。我可以使用以下代码更改事件选项卡:navbar.component.html☰MyAppHome(current)AboutExample行:[routerLinkActive]="['active']"[routerLinkActiveOptions]="{exact:true}"在切换到当前事件选项卡时效果很好,但是当我使用类似以下内容导航到组件时:this.router.navigate(['']);事件标签不会改变。有没有办法在像上面那样导航时更改事件选项卡? 最佳答案

html - 使用 router.navigate 时更改导航栏中的事件选项卡

我将Angular2与Bootstrap4结合使用。我可以使用以下代码更改事件选项卡:navbar.component.html☰MyAppHome(current)AboutExample行:[routerLinkActive]="['active']"[routerLinkActiveOptions]="{exact:true}"在切换到当前事件选项卡时效果很好,但是当我使用类似以下内容导航到组件时:this.router.navigate(['']);事件标签不会改变。有没有办法在像上面那样导航时更改事件选项卡? 最佳答案

已解决vue-router4路由报“[Vue Router warn]: No match found for location with path“

vue-router4动态加载的模式下,当我们在当前页面刷新浏览器时,会出现一个警告[VueRouterwarn]:Nomatchfoundforlocationwithpath百度了很久基本上没解决方案,虽然只是警告但还是看着不爽,这个原因是刷新页面时请求路由为空,因为追加路由是在addRoute里做的,请求路由比addRoute早所以出现这问题。解决:在路由文件后追加一个404路由文件,其他刷都不用加 { path:'/:catchAll(.*)', hidden:true, component:()=>import('@/views/error/404.vue')//这个是我自己的

Vue中router-view无法显示

如果你存在:代码没报错,运行成功,但是index.js中router挂接的内容无法显示,没有犯书写错误,routes和component没有写错,在浏览器中检查,App.vue中对应的为空那么建议你接着看,首先,正确的结果://App.vue中//关键是router-view能否成功渲染IfElementissuccessfullyaddedtothisproject,you'llseean'">belowel-buttonexportdefault{name:'app',components:{}}//index.js文件importVuefrom'vue'importVueRouterfr

html - ui-router 的 $urlRouterProvider.otherwise 与 HTML5 模式

考虑以下来自ui-router的wiki的稍作修改的代码。varmyApp=angular.module('myApp',['ui.router']);myApp.config(function($stateProvider,$urlRouterProvider,$locationProvider){//foranyunmatchedurl$urlRouterProvider.otherwise("/state1");$locationProvider.html5Mode(true);//nowsetupthestates$stateProvider.state('state1',{u

html - ui-router 的 $urlRouterProvider.otherwise 与 HTML5 模式

考虑以下来自ui-router的wiki的稍作修改的代码。varmyApp=angular.module('myApp',['ui.router']);myApp.config(function($stateProvider,$urlRouterProvider,$locationProvider){//foranyunmatchedurl$urlRouterProvider.otherwise("/state1");$locationProvider.html5Mode(true);//nowsetupthestates$stateProvider.state('state1',{u

javascript - CSS 文件 : SyntaxError: expected expression, 得到 '.'

我已经将一个css文件包含到我的AngularJS应用程序中,就像我对其他css文件所做的那样。对于其他css文件,它工作正常,但对于management.css文件,我在图片中遇到了以下异常,我不知道为什么。有人暗示我做错了什么吗?非常感谢![编辑].management.management-name{font-weight:bold;}.management.management-username{font-style:italic;}.management.management-email{color:#ccc;}.management.managementSearchUser

javascript - CSS 文件 : SyntaxError: expected expression, 得到 '.'

我已经将一个css文件包含到我的AngularJS应用程序中,就像我对其他css文件所做的那样。对于其他css文件,它工作正常,但对于management.css文件,我在图片中遇到了以下异常,我不知道为什么。有人暗示我做错了什么吗?非常感谢![编辑].management.management-name{font-weight:bold;}.management.management-username{font-style:italic;}.management.management-email{color:#ccc;}.management.managementSearchUser

React Router@3.x 升级到 @6.x 的实施方案

我们是袋鼠云数栈UED团队,致力于打造优秀的一站式数据中台产品。我们始终保持工匠精神,探索前端道路,为社区积累并传播经验价值。本文作者:景明升级背景目前公司产品有关react的工具版本普遍较低,其中reactrouter版本为3.x(是的,没有看错,3.x的版本)。而最新的reactrouter已经到了6.x版本。为了能够跟上路由的脚步,也为了使用router相关的hooks函数,一次必不可少的升级由此到来!版本确定react-touter6.x版本,只对react和react-dom版本有要求,我们的项目满足条件。"peerDependencies":{"react":">=16.8","r